## Local Setup

The Quillhaven catalogue importer requires the MARC fixtures to be unpacked into `data/records` before the first run. Run `make seed` to normalise shelf codes, then verify row counts against the manifest — mismatches usually mean a truncated fixture archive. Once seeding completes cleanly, point the importer at the staging catalogue database using the connection string below.

replica DSN, kajep-yahag: mssql://praok_svc:iF@db-8d68.plorvaio.local:5432/eliion

## Releases

Gatecount, the turnstile counter for the Harlowe Dome, ships signed release tarballs only. Each artifact includes a detached signature generated in an isolated build cell; verify it before any review or deployment, and reject unsigned builds outright. Checksums alone are not sufficient. Verify all release signatures against the public key below.

signing key of bagap-yawep = bky13_TbfT6ZMUoGJo2

Handover for eng sync — flaky DNS, Quillstack staging

Intermittent NXDOMAIN on internal resolver since Tuesday. Affects the Brindlemoor cluster only; prod untouched. Suspect stale cache on resolver node 2 after the subnet migration. Mitigation: forced TTL to 30s, added retry in the service mesh. Root cause still open — handing to Varek's team. Resolver admin console is sealed; unlock it with the passphrase below.

recovery phrase for tagug-yagug: lamox-gilax-keleth-gilath

Capacity note for the Bramblewick export retry queue. Failed exports are requeued with exponential backoff, and the queue depth is our main capacity signal: sustained depth above the high-water mark means downstream Pellis storage is saturated, not that we need more workers. As the new contractor, please don't raise worker counts without checking storage latency first — it usually makes things worse. Retry timing, backoff caps, and the high-water threshold are all driven by the constants shown below.

limits module of yagef-bajog:
TIERS = {
    "druael": 370,
    "tamix": 286,
    "pelius": 541,
    "pelael": 78,
    "pelox": 47,
    "ralath": 533,
    "drumir": 801,
}